摘要:

目的 动物照度是实验动物设施中维持动物昼夜节律,保障动物福利的重要条件。通过公开报名的形式,组织参比实验室进行现场检测,对参比实验室检测数据的准确性做出评估,并对检测方法提出建议。 方法 本次能力验证活动的待测样品为中检院实验动物实验设施内相邻的两间豚鼠饲养间,动物照明灯使用稳压电源供电的COB灯(板载芯片灯,Chip On Board Light)作为光源,通过线性调节电压输出改变光源亮度。采用分割水平样品对的形式设定两个房间的动物照度,参比实验室参照GB 14925-2023《实验动物 环境及设施》要求的方法进行检测。样品均匀性和稳定性满足CNAS-RL02:2023《能力验证规则》、CNAS-GL002:2018《能力验证统计处理与评价指南》和CNAS-GL003:2018《能力验证样品均匀性和稳定性评价指南》的要求。每个参比实验室被赋予了1个3位数随机代码,分别对每个饲养间进行2次测试,现场提交检测报告、原始记录和照度计检定或校准证书。能力验证的指定值为各参比实验室的中位值,采用稳健Z比分数法对各实验室检测结果进行评价,并从人员、设备、操作环境等方面对影响结果的因素进行了分析。 结果 本次能力验证共有35家参比实验室参与并完成现场检测和提交报告。34家实验室结果被评定为“满意”,1家实验室结果为“不满意”。 结论 通过分析发现部分参比实验室照度计计量位点数量及范围不足,检测结果未能充分反应设施照度的真实性。设施照度测试环境较昏暗,建议检使用具有无线探头和可存储功能的照度计提高检测效率。

Abstract:

Objective Illuminance for animals is an important condition for maintaining circadian rhythms and safeguarding animal welfare in laboratory animal facilities. By means of open enrolment, the participating laboratories are organised to carry out on-site testing, to assess the accuracy of the testing data of the participating laboratories and to make suggestions on the testing methods. Methods The samples to be tested in this proficiency testing activity were two adjacent guinea pig rearing rooms in the laboratory animal experimental facilities. The animal lighting used COB lamps (Chip On Board Light) powered by regulated power supply as the light source, and the brightness of the light source was changed by linearly adjusting the voltage output. Split-level test sample pairs were used to set Illuminance for animals in both rooms, and the reference laboratory refers to the method required by GB 14925-2023 Laboratory Animals-Environment and Facilities for testing. Sample uniformity and stability meet the requirements of CNAS-RL02:2023 Proficiency Testing Rules, CNAS-GL002:2018 Guidelines for Statistical Treatment and Evaluation of Proficiency Testing Results, and CNAS-GL003:2018 Guidelines for Homogeneity and Stability Assessment of Proficiency Testing Samples. Each reference laboratory was assigned a 3-digit random code to conduct 2 tests for each rearing compartment respectively, and submit the test report, original records and the certificate of calibration or verification of the illuminometer on site. The assigned value for proficiency testing was the median value of each participating laboratory. The robust Z-score method was used to evaluate the test results of each laboratory, and the factors affecting the results were analysed in terms of personnel, equipment and operating environment. Results A total of 35 participating laboratories participated in the proficiency testing, completed the on-site testing and submitted the reports. 34 laboratories were rated as 'satisfactory' and 1 laboratory was rated as 'unsatisfactory'. Conclusion It was found that the number and range of illuminance measurement points of some participating laboratories were insufficient, and the test results failed to fully reflect the authenticity of the illuminance of the facilities. Illuminance for animal testing environment is dim, it is recommended to use illuminance meter with wireless probe and storage function to improve testing efficiency.
